Etihad Stadium is a state-of-the-art, multipurpose venue with a history of hosting an amazing array of world-class sports and entertainment events.
The venue has hosted many significant sporting events including the Commonwealth Games Rugby 7s, a World Title boxing match, an NRL State of Origin match, a soccer World Cup Qualifier, Rugby Union Test matches, international cricket as well as hundreds of AFL and A-League matches including finals.
The list of entertainment events is equally impressive with Etihad Stadium having hosted U2, Robbie Williams, the Red Hot Chilli Peppers, Andre Rieu, Barbra Streisand, Kiss, Bon Jovi, Sensation, Rumba, WWE Global Warning Tour, a Catholic Jubilee Mass and the Days in the Dioceses Commissioning Mass.
More than 19 million people have attended the venue since it opened in 2000 proving it is as popular with the fans and spectators as with the sports stars and performers themselves.

| U2 November 11, 2006 – 62,371, November 19, 2006 – 63,110. |
| State of Origin Game 3 July 5, 2006 – 52,214. |
| Robbie Williams December 17, 2006 – 63,690, December 18, 2006 – 64,619. |
| Hyundai A-League Grand Final February 2, 2007 – 55,436. |
| Sensation December 31, 2008 – 38,380 (World Record). |
| WWE Global Warning Tour August 10, 2002 – 56,328. |
| Andre Rieu November 13, 2008 – 20,677, November 14, 2008 – 28,686, November 15, 2008 – 36,543 (World Record). |
| Rugby Union Test Match (Wallabies v British Lions) June 6, 2003 – 52,103. |
| Catholic Jubilee Mass November 15, 2000 – 70,000. |
| Soccer (Melbourne Victory v Juventus) May 30, 2008 – 43,357. |
| International Rules Series (Australia v Ireland) October 10, 2005 – 45,428. |
